At 05:49 AM 11/17/2007, Betty wrote:
>One reminder is that for, HeritageQuest, I believe in most Libraries, you
>must be a resident of the town in order to access it via your home computer.
That is the case here. The Roanoke City Library offers home access to
HQ Online. We have, however, a Roanoke Valley library co-op, where
residents of the cities of Roanoke and Salem, and those of Botetourt
and Roanoke counties, have access to all resources of all four
library systems. That means that I can use my Roanoke County library
card number to log into the Roanoke City Library site and access HQ
online from home.
The City Library also has Ancestry, but that can only be accessed at
the library.
